The Saudi Arabia Cotton Processing Market was estimated at USD 424 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 544 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 3.6% from 2026 to 2032. This anticipated growth is largely driven by the increasing demand for raw materials in the textile and garment sectors, fueled by a surge in local manufacturing initiatives. As consumer preferences shift towards high-quality and sustainable textile products, there is an urgent need for efficient cotton processing solutions that meet strict quality standards.
The Saudi Arabia cotton processing market exhibited notable fluctuations in growth between 2021 and 2023, starting with a decline of 1.6% in 2021 due to pandemic-related disruptions. However, a robust recovery ensued, with growth rates reaching 6.1% in 2022 and an impressive 10.9% in 2023, driven by increased consumer demand and investments in processing technology. The trend is expected to sustain, with projected growth rates of 1.3% in 2024 and up to 4.6% by 2026, influenced by ongoing digitalization and enhanced infrastructure. As the nation increasingly shifts towards sustainable practices and energy transition, the cotton market is well-positioned for steady growth through 2032, with fluctuations reflecting both local consumer trends and broader economic factors.

The growing trend of domestic textile production in Saudi Arabia is directly impacting the cotton processing market. Enhanced investments in technology and manufacturing capabilities are expected to elevate the standard of cotton processing, allowing for higher purity and consistency in cotton fibers. The continuous expansion of the local apparel market is driving the demand for properly processed cotton, positioning ginning and spinning facilities as critical players in the supply chain.
Moreover, as sustainability becomes a paramount concern among consumers, processors who can deliver high-quality, contaminant-free cotton are poised for success. The synergy between traditional cotton processing methods and innovative technologies will be essential in meeting the evolving expectations of both manufacturers and consumers in the Saudi market.
Despite the favorable growth outlook, the Saudi Arabia cotton processing market faces certain limitations. The COVID-19 pandemic has left lingering effects on the global supply chain, affecting the availability of raw cotton and creating volatility in market prices. Additionally, the reliance on imported machinery and technologies can pose challenges for local processors. Fluctuating cotton yields, influenced by climate conditions, also represent a risk to consistent supply and market stability, potentially hindering growth opportunities.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
